INTERNAL - Webcasts - How do I prepare a Customer for their educational webcast?
Follow the steps provided to prepare your Customer for their educational webcast.
Step 1: Schedule the webcast.
Once a Customer has determined the webcast topic, schedule the webcast using the the steps provided in the article How Do I Schedule a Webcast?
Step 2: Send the Customer the title-specific webcast marketing template in HubSpot.
The template includes a description of the Webcast, a webcast outline, and an email template. The Customer can share these documents with their team and anyone invited to the webcast.
Step 3: Send the Customer the marketing materials for their webcast.
Each webcast should have an email template, a pdf description image, and an email image. You may also send the Webcast Team Members and Webcast Registration documents to answer many of their questions.
Step 4: Schedule a panelist prep meeting (if requested).
Approximately 5 weeks out from the webcast date, schedule a panelist prep meeting (if the Customer feels necessary) and email the HubSpot webcast-specific panelist prep template to your Customer. This includes: the webcast agenda, the webcast outline, panelist prep questions, and the Webcast Team Members.
These templates may be forwarded from your email account; please ensure you're including the correct webcast title when forwarding these documents.
Invite the following people to the panelist prep meeting:
- Point of Contact
- Panelist (if different than POC)
Note: The presenter does not need to be included in the prep. See How to Run a Panelist Prep Meeting.
Step 5: Ensure your POC and panelists have received the Teams link to their webcast.
Approximately 2 weeks before the webcast, please make sure your POC and panelists have received their Teams link (or you have received their platform link).
